معرفی بهترین زبان های برنامه نویسی(آپدیت)
امروزه دنیای تکنولوژی با سرعتی چشم گیر در حال پیشرفت است. این مسیری است که برنامه نویسی و دنیای کامپیوتر دنیا را به سمت و سوی هوشمند شدن برای انسان میبرد. با تصور دنیای هوشمند تر و داشتن توانایی کد نویسی شما هم میتوانید تاثیر گذار باشید. از جذابیت های دنیای کامپیوتر به نقش در آوردن تصورات شماست. با بمب کد همراه ما باشید تا بهترین زبان های برنامه نویسی را به شما معرفی کنیم.
پس آموزش برنامه نویسی در واقعی ساختن رویا های شما ضروری است. از دید یک برنامه نویس دنیا به شکل کد نویسی است. در بخش های مختلف برنامه نویسی انواع مختلفی از زبان ها موجود است. هر کدام از این زبان ها پایه و اساسی دارند و مناسب بخش های متفاوت هستند. آشنایی با انواع عملکرد زبان های برنامه نویسی به شما کمک می کند در مناسب ترین کلاس آموزش برنامه نویسی را شروع کنید. با معروف ترین زبان های برنامه نویسی آشنا شوید:
• Python
• Java
• JavaScript
• Swift
• Php
• C#
• C++
• Kotlin
• Go
• Sql
آموزش برنامه نویسی با Python
برای آموزش برنامه نویسی توجه داشته باشید هر زبان بر چه مبنایی است. زبان پایتون، زبانی سطح بالاست. نخستین بار در سال 1991 عرضه شد. پایتون زبانی قابل فهم است که به کاربر پسند بودن توجه ویژه ای دارد. از دسته زبان های مبتنی بر شئ است و نبود syntax آن را شبیه به زبان انگلیسی کرده. آموزش برنامه نویسی پایتون به نوعی آسان است ولی توجه کنید با زمینه کاری شما تا چه حد هماهنگ است.
پایتون در بیشتر زمینه ها موفق است از جمله می توان به: شاخه علم داده، آمار، تحلیل، هوش مصنوعی اشاره کرد. برای آموزش برنامه نویسی می توانید با این زبان شروع کنید. برای نمونه گیری و آزمایش به منظور توسعه نرم افزار ها از پایتون استفاده میشود. آخرین نسخه ارائه شده از پایتون نسخه سه است. در این زبان برای جدا کردن هر خط کد ازسمی کولن استفاده نمیشود بلکه به آسانی به خط بعد می رویم.
نکته تمایز ای که در فرایند آموزش برنامه نویسی با آن رو به رو خواهید شد. بمب کد تمامی این نکات را در اختیار شما می گذارد ولی حتما تمرین مستمر داشته باشید تا مفاهیم را بخوبی فرا بگیرید.
مزایای برنامه نویسی با Python
• پشتیبانی از سیستم عامل های مختلف.
• مبتنی بر برنامه نویسی شئ گراست.
• به راحتی امکان اندازه گیری را حتی با پیچیده ترین برنامه ها را میدهد.
• پشتیبانی از کتابخانه ای گسترده
معایب برنامه نویسی با Python
• مناسب برای برنامه نویسی موبایل مناسب
• لایه دسترسی به پایگاه داده پایتون ابتدایی است.
کاربردبرنامه نویسی با Python
• برای توسعه در اینترنت، برنامه های علمی و عددی، رابط کاربری گرافیکی و برنامه ها تجاری مناسب است. بطور کلی در هوش مصنوعی و یادگیری با زبان ماشین استفاده می شود.
آموزش برنامه نویسی Java
این زبان طی 20 سال اخیر عرضه شده است و یکی از دلایل محبوبیت جاوا در نحوه اجرا آن است. پس از نوشتن در همه جا اجرا می شود. جاوا زبانی شئ گرا و قدرتمند است چرا که داده های آن هیچ مرجعی ندارند. برای آموزش برنامه نویسی جاوا بهتر است بدانید که از زبان ++c آسان تر است. علت این امر در تخصیص خودکار حافظه است.
خوبی های زبان برنامه نویسی جاوا زیاد است. از ویژگی های خوب آن مسئله cross-platform است. به این معنا که در دستگاه های مختلف یا پکیج های متفاوت استفاده می شود. و خوب در نهایت بروی هر نوع پلتفرمی به کمک پلتفرم JVM اجرا میشود. شاید جالب باشد یا حتی متوجه شده باشید که پایه و اساس سیستم عامل اندورید، به زبان جاوا نوشته شده. خبر خوب برای تازه کاران اینکه این زبان برای آموزش برنامه نویسی مناسب شماست. دلیل آن در سادگی این زبان برنامه نویسی است. با بمب کد همراه باشید.
مزایای برنامه نویسی Java
• حافظه قوی، امنیت بالا، سازگاری خوب
• داشتن کاربران زیاد در آمازون ، توییتر ، گوگل و یوتیوب
• زبانی شئ گرا
• Api های متفاوت برای اهداف متفاوت
• داشتن ابزار قدرتمند در توسعه این زبان متن باز
• تعداد زیادی کتابخانه متن باز دارد.
معایب برنامه نویسی Java
• برای جاوا مدیریت حافظه گران تمام می شود.
• عدم وجود الگویی در جهت محدودیت ساخت ساختار داده با کیفیت
کاربرد
• جاوا بطور معمول برای توسعه برنامه های اندرویدی، برنامه های اینترنتی و همچنین در حوزه big data استفاده میشود.
آموزش برنامه نویسی Java script
جاوا اسکریپت نوعی زبان میان HTML و CSS برای ساخت صفحات وب می باشد که در سال 1995 عرضه شد. برای برنامه نویسان، توسعه بدون جاوا اسکریپت بی معناست. جاوا اسکریپت نقشی موثر در back end دارد. در ابتدا به عنوان زبانی ساده برای سمت کاربر بود ولی حالا بخشی موثر در دنیای وب سایت نویسی هم در back end و هم در front end است.
حتی بعضی از پلتفرم ها نبود این زبان را عیب می دانند. دلیل این امر سازگاری با تمامی مرورگر هاست. جاوا اسکریپت نشان داده چقدر انعطاف پذیر است. همچنین به جز حضور در back end در بخش سرور node.js نیز حضور دارد. خبر خوب برای تازه کاران آموزش برنامه نویسی با java script میتواند پیشنهاد خوبی برای شما باشد.
مسیر آموزش برنامه نویسی باید به سمت علایق شما باشد. به کمک سایت بمب کد ابتدا اصول و الگوریتم های موجود را یاد بگیرید. در قدم بعدی یادگیری مفاهیم ساده است. این مفاهیم بطورکلی در بیشتر زبان های برنامه نویسی یکسان هستند. که از مفاهیم متغیر، آرایه، شرط، توابع و… تشکیل میشود. ولی نگران نباشید بمب کد شما را همراهی میکند تا با آموزش برنامه نویسی صحیح و تمرین پیشرفت کنید.
مزیت برنامه نویسی جاوا اسکریپت
• سرعت خوب بارگذاری در سمت کاربر
• یادگیری ساده
• قابلیت کار کردن با انواع زبان های برنامه نویسی و استفاده در برنامه های متنوع
• دارای کتابخانه و چهار چوب های محبوب در کد نویسی
• پشتیبانی آسان از json، jQuery، Angular، React js
معایب برنامه نویسی جاوا اسکریپت
• روشی برای کپی موجود نیست.
کاربرد
• در توسعه برنامه ها وب یا موبایلی، بازی و یا desktop استفاده میشود.
آموزش برنامه نویسی Swift
Swift یک زبان برنامه نویسی متن باز است که در سال 2014 عرضه شده. این زبان توسط اپل کامپایل و توسعه میشود. بطور کلی زبان اصلی در برنامه نویسی Ios و mac os می باشد. این زبان از پایتون و روبی الهام گرفته است. در نتیجه کاربرد پسند است و استفاده از آن جالب است.
تفاوت آن در سریعتر بودن این زبان است ولی نکات دیگری هم هست که برای یک برنامه نویس بسیار مهم است. ویژگی بعدی آن در امنیت زبان برنامه نویسی است. همچنین در بخش اشکال زدایی پیشرفت داشته و به نسبت امری آسان تر از پایتون است. در نتیجه آموزش برنامه نویسی swift آسان است.
یکی از دلایل آن در تفاوت swift با زبان شبه C است. این زبان از قوانینی پیروی میکند که در Swift لزومی به اجرا ندارد. در نتیجه زبانی مبتنی بر C نیست. نکته مهم درباره این زبان برنامه نویسی در سطح آن است.
سطح و زمینه این زبان تخصصی است. شاید ابتدا در فرایند آموزش برنامه نویسی به مشکل بخورید که کاملا طبیعی است بمب کد اینجاست تا به شما کمک کند. در یادگیری وجود فردی که به شما کمک کند و سوال هایتان را بپرسید ضروری است.
حال نقش بمب کد همین است برای بسیاری از افراد وجود فردی فیزیکی امکان پذیر نیست ولی نگران نباشید بمب کد در روند آموزش برنامه نویسی کنار شماست و بطور آنلاین به شما کمک میکند. احتمالا از این زبان بخاطر اختصاصی بودن آن خوشتان بیاید که البته مورد توجه برنامه نویسان هم بوده است ولی اگر به زمینه های دیگر هم علاقه مندید آموزش برنامه نویسی در زبان های دیگر را دنبال کنید.
مزایای برنامه نویسی Swift
• به کد کمتری احتیاج دارد
• خوانایی آسان کدنویسی چون به زبان انگلیسی نزدیک هستند.
• دارای مدیریت حافظه
معایب برنامه نویسی Swift
• به دلیل بروزرسانی های مداوم اپل، swift پایدار نیست.
• زبان برنامه نویسی جدیدی است درنتیجه در حوزه کاری محدودیت دارد.
کاربرد
• به طور تخصصی برای سیستم عامل ios ساخته شده. تا برنامه نویسان این حوزه از آن استفاده کنند. به دلیل جدید بودن این زبان موفقیت در این حوزه احتمال بیشتری دارد.
آموزش برنامه نویسی Php
زبان برنامه نویسی Php نوعی زبان اسکریپت است که روی سرور اجرا می شود. این زبان در سال 1994 عرضه شد. زبانی که در ابتدا برای کنترل یک صفحه اصلی کاربرد داشته حالا اکثر وب سایت ها حاوی کد های php هستند. این زبان به دلایل مختلفی در میان برنامه نویسان محبوبیت دارد. بطور مثال این زبان رایگان است و نحوه نصب و استفاده از آن برای برنامه نویسان آسان است.
در نتیجه یکی از گزینه هایی خوب برای آموزش برنامه نویسی بشمار میرود. Php بخاطر قابلیتی که دارد در تمام دنیا مورد توجه است به منظور ساخت وب سایتی ایستا به همراه محتوا و رسانه از آن استفاده میشود. همچنین این زبان بسیار مناسب ورد پرس است. با بمب کد همراه باشید تا دلایل جذابیت این زبان برنامه نویسی آشنا شوید.
در واقع php یکی از زبان های محبوب برای back end است. این زبان در میان پایتون و جاوا اسکریپت در رقابت است. موضوع ویژه ای که در خصوص این زبان وجود دارد در بازار کار آن است با توجه به رشد php به برنامه نویسان بیشتری در این حوزه نیاز است. پس ممکن است انتخاب خوبی برای آموزش برنامه نویسی باشد. این حوزه بطور کلی عناوین مختلفی دارد و امکان پیشرفت در آن سرعت بیشتری به نسبت سایرین دارد.
با توجه به عملکرد هر زبان بهترین انتخاب آموزش برنامه نویسی را کسب کنید. بمب کد به شما کمک می کند تا php را بیشتر بشناسید. در فرایند آموزش برنامه نویسی مسئله مهم آشنایی با مفاهیم پایه است چرا که روند یادگیری را سرعت میبخشد. مرحله بعد توانایی بکار گیری کد در یک پروژه واقعیست. به همراه بمب کد به آسانی به این مرحله خواهید رسید و مسیر آموزش برنامه نویسی برای شما لذت بخش خواهد شد.
مزایای برنامه نویسی Php
• دارای چهارچوب های متنوع و قوی
• آسانی در یادگیری
• آسانی در ساخت یک صفحه وب
• دارای انجمن های یادگیری متعدد
• دارای ابزار های خودکار برای اشکال یابی
• پشتیبانی از برنامه نویسی شئ گرا
معایب برنامه نویسی Php
• ضعف در کنترل خطا
• عدم امنیت به دلیل متن باز بودن آن
• برنامه نویسی با آن کند است.
کاربرد
• در زمینه برنامه های وب، سیستم های مدیریت محتوا و برنامه ها تجارت الکترونیکی کاربرد دارد.
ادامه مقاله در سایت زیر
http://bombecode.ir/introducing-the-best-programming-languages/